I really really enjoyed this arc and thought that the art matched the plot flawlessly, both were violet and colourful and I just loved it!
I was honestly astonished that I really really enjoyed the Kite Man origin story which intertwined with the the main plot. Kite Man for me went from being an annoyance to one of the most heartwrenching characters featured within King's Batman run.
The War itself was also great! Of course that may just be me being bias as the two sides were headed by my favourite big bads of Gotham. But I was intrigued with who would side with which villain, and loved any panel featuring Jim Gordon being the brave, Gotham loving, guy that he is.
Another thing I was pleasantly surprised with was the reveal of one of Bruce's most shameful moments, when he first started hinting at it to Cat I was just about ready to roll my eyes thinking that Bats was just being his over-dramatic self but upon hearing what he almost did I could understand why he would feel that way.
Overall, strong arc with minor flaws and fantastic art.

There was a lot of build up for this arc and I was excited to read it, but the end result seems to have fallen a little bit short. My main problem was that the atrocities and horrors of this war were never shown, they were explained in great details and referred to countless times, but I think seeing it would have made a difference. Secondly, no matter how tragic you make his back story or how badass you make his vengeance on the Ridler, Kiteman is still Kite man.
